Isolated thunderstorms are expected through the evening. The overall risk of severe weather remains low, though a couple of storms could produce wind gust near 40 mph. .DAYS TWO THROUGH SEVEN...Monday through Saturday... Occasional thunderstorm activity will remain possible in the Georgia through at least Thursday. Rain chances are highest on Wednesday and Thursday. Widespread severe weather is not anticipated at this time. .SPOTTER INFORMATION STATEMENT... Spotter activation will not be needed through tonight. $$
